Özet
Continuous respiratory monitoring is crucial for the early detection of fatal diseases. Invasive respiratory devices that restrict mobility are used for respiratory monitoring. Implementing these sensors in wearable devices is not always easy. In this study, respiratory rate was estimated from the ECG signal without using an additional sensor. The ECG-derived respiration (EDR) signal was obtained by interpolating the R-peak amplitude values of the ECG. This signal was processed using a bandpass filter and the Fast Fourier Transform (FFT) to estimate respiratory rate. All operations are performed on a fixed-point microcontroller with low power consumption and low processing power for maximum speed and minimum memory usage. The accuracy of the implemented algorithm was demonstrated using data from a BIOPAC device.
